Filezilla is a free, open source FTP client. It supports FTP, , and FTPS (FTP over SSL/). The client is available under many platforms, binaries for Windows, Linux and Mac OS X are provided. Filezilla can be downloaded and used to access your Home Directory from off campus.


Download Filezilla

To download the latest version of Filezilla, click the following link: , then select the appropriate client to download for your platform. Follow through download, run then install commands.

Map Home Directory

Windows 7

  1. From the start menu, locate Filezilla under its saved location then open it
  2. Along the Quickconnect bar, enter ftp.gac.edu in the Host Bar then follow with your username and password. Leave the Port open.
  3. Click Quickconnect
  4. Select establish a new connection, then click OK. (Your home directory should open up as a new tab along the right side your current tab.)
  5. Select the files which you would like to transfer

Mac OS X

  1. From the Spolight, locate Filezilla under the its saved location then open it
  2. Along the Quickconnect bar, enter ftp.gac.edu in the Host Bar then follow with your username and password. Leave the Port open.
  3. Click Quickconnect
  4. Select establish a new connection, then click OK. (Your home directory should open up as a new tab along the right side your current tab.)
  5. Select the files which you would like to transfer
